#4f1f56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f1f56 is composed of 31% red, 12.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 292.4 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 22.9%. #4f1f56 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e3eac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#4f1f56 color description : Very dark magenta.
#4f1f56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f1f56 has RGB values of R:79, G:31,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5185366.

Shades and Tints of #4f1f56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d050e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f1f56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3a3b is the less saturated color, while #630471 is the most saturated one.
